* [PATCH] smp/hotplug: move step CPUHP_AP_SMPCFD_DYING to the correct place

31487f8328f2("smp/cfd: Convert core to hotplug state machine")
accidently put this step on the wrong place. The step should
be at the cpuhp_ap_states[] rather than the cpuhp_bp_states[].

grep smpcfd /sys/devices/system/cpu/hotplug/states
 40: smpcfd:prepare
129: smpcfd:dying

"smpcfd:dying" was missing before.
So was the invocation of the function smpcfd_dying_cpu().

---
 kernel/cpu.c | 10 +++++-----
 1 file changed, 5 insertions(+), 5 deletions(-)

diff --git a/kernel/cpu.c b/kernel/cpu.c
index 04892a82f6ac..7891aecc6aec 100644
--- a/kernel/cpu.c
+++ b/kernel/cpu.c
@@ -1289,11 +1289,6 @@ static struct cpuhp_step cpuhp_bp_states[] = {
 		.teardown.single	= NULL,
 		.cant_stop		= true,
 	},
-	[CPUHP_AP_SMPCFD_DYING] = {
-		.name			= "smpcfd:dying",
-		.startup.single		= NULL,
-		.teardown.single	= smpcfd_dying_cpu,
-	},
 	/*
 	 * Handled on controll processor until the plugged processor manages
 	 * this itself.
@@ -1335,6 +1330,11 @@ static struct cpuhp_step cpuhp_ap_states[] = {
 		.startup.single		= NULL,
 		.teardown.single	= rcutree_dying_cpu,
 	},
+	[CPUHP_AP_SMPCFD_DYING] = {
+		.name			= "smpcfd:dying",
+		.startup.single		= NULL,
+		.teardown.single	= smpcfd_dying_cpu,
+	},
 	/* Entry state on starting. Interrupts enabled from here on. Transient
 	 * state for synchronsization */
 	[CPUHP_AP_ONLINE] = {
